WAGE: $19.00 - $21.00/hourly            JOB SUMMARY: Catholic Charities is seeking a compassionate, trauma-informed, and culturally aware individual to work as an on-call/casual Housing Support Representative II at our Dorothy Day Residence. This position may work overnights and weekends.  The Housing Support Representative will act as a liaison and provide superior customer service while assisting residents, outside agency providers, and vendors.  Under general supervision, they will maintain a clean, safe, and secure environment for residents by providing referral information on a wide variety of topics.  They will assist in resolution and de-escalation of emerging problems or situations that residents may face and ensure that rules and policies are consistently enforced.  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S 1. Manage incoming calls. 2. Assist residents with inquiries and ensure that issues are resolved both promptly and thoroughly. 3. Manage and enforce visiting policy and process. 4. Provide quality service and support in variety of areas, including, but not limited to, maintenance requests, complaints, grievances, resources and referrals. 5. May administer medications according to established procedures and guidelines. 6. Be vigilant of surroundings and utilize conflict resolution and de-escalation skills to defuse crisis situations, as required. 7. Complete regular rounds, checking all exits, fire doors, and common areas, as well as monitoring residents’ activities in common areas to ensure safety and security. 8. Respond and handle issues in the best interest of the resident, building, and organization by regular identification of opportunities that positively impact the resident’s experience. 9. Assist Property Manager with running reports, completing forms, document management and data entry, as required. 10. Responsible for reviewing and ensuring the relevance, accuracy and timeliness of data and reporting for purposes of accountability and client outcomes. 11. Other duties as assigned M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S/EXPERTISE: * Experience working with low-income and culturally diverse populations, including individuals experiencing homelessness, housing instability, mental illness, or other significant life challenges. * High school diploma or equivalent required; post-secondary education preferred. * Minimum of one year of experience in a human services, social services, or community support role * Strong commitment to integrity, professionalism, and resident/tenant satisfaction. * Effective verbal and written communication skills. * Ability to accurately enter, track, and maintain data in electronic systems for documentation and reporting. Windows-based experience preferred.
